From 81ff1a8f7822b783f35de019e4f4cc670de2e5ea Mon Sep 17 00:00:00 2001 From: Codex Date: Fri, 24 Apr 2026 19:41:41 +0100 Subject: [PATCH] chore(go-webview): clarify encoding/base64 rationale comment (AX-6) Reworded the existing `// Note:` annotation on encoding/base64 import in webview.go to explicitly state that core has no equivalent decoder yet (CDP Page.captureScreenshot returns PNG as base64-encoded data). Closes tasks.lthn.sh/view.php?id=286 Co-authored-by: Codex --- webview.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/webview.go b/webview.go index b1cf49f..11bb0f2 100644 --- a/webview.go +++ b/webview.go @@ -24,7 +24,7 @@ package webview import ( "context" - "encoding/base64" // Note: intrinsic — CDP Page.captureScreenshot returns PNG as base64-encoded string; stdlib decoder is the protocol requirement + "encoding/base64" // Note: encoding/base64 — PNG screenshot decode from Chrome DevTools Protocol; no core equivalent exists yet. "iter" // Note: intrinsic — stdlib iterator primitive for Seq[ConsoleMessage] / Seq[*ElementInfo] return types "slices" // Note: intrinsic — slices.Collect materialises console message iterator into a snapshot "sync"